Understanding Game Blocking
Before delving into solutions, it’s essential to understand why games may be blocked. Common reasons include:
- Network Restrictions: Many schools and workplaces implement firewalls to prevent access to gaming sites.
- Geographical Restrictions: Certain games may be unavailable in specific regions due to licensing agreements.
- Parental Controls: Parents may restrict access to certain games for safety or age-appropriateness.
Method 1: Using a VPN to Unblock Games
What is a VPN?
A Virtual Private Network (VPN) is a powerful tool that allows users to create a secure connection to another network over the Internet. VPNs can help you bypass restrictions by masking your IP address and making it appear as though you are accessing the Internet from a different location.
How to Use a VPN to Unblock Games
- Choose a Reliable VPN Service: Select a reputable VPN provider that offers high-speed servers and strong encryption. Popular options include NordVPN, ExpressVPN, and CyberGhost.
- Download and Install the VPN Application: Follow the instructions to install the application on your device. Most VPNs support multiple platforms, including Windows, macOS, Android, and iOS.
- Connect to a VPN Server: Launch the VPN application and connect to a server located in a region where the game is accessible.
- Access the Game: Once connected, open your game client or website, and you should be able to access the blocked content without restrictions.

Method 2: Using a Proxy Server
What is a Proxy Server?
A proxy server acts as an intermediary between your device and the Internet. By routing your requests through the proxy, you can access blocked content.
Steps to Use a Proxy Server
- Find a Reliable Proxy Service: Look for a trustworthy proxy provider that offers dedicated gaming proxies. Free proxies may be available, but they often come with limitations.
- Configure Your Device’s Proxy Settings: Access your device’s network settings and enter the proxy server details provided by your chosen service.
- Launch Your Game: Open your game client or website. The proxy will allow you to bypass any restrictions in place.

Method 3: Changing DNS Settings
Understanding DNS
Domain Name System (DNS) is responsible for translating domain names into IP addresses. By changing your DNS settings, you can bypass certain restrictions.
Steps to Change DNS Settings
- Access Network Settings: Go to your device’s network settings. This can typically be found in the Control Panel for Windows or System Preferences for macOS.
- Select Your Network Connection: Choose the connection you are using (Wi-Fi or Ethernet).
- Change DNS Server Addresses: Replace the existing DNS addresses with public DNS servers such as:
- Google DNS:
8.8.8.8
and8.8.4.4
- OpenDNS:
208.67.222.222
and208.67.220.220
- Save Changes: Apply the settings and restart your connection.
